Web16 ago 2016 · The Clean Seas fish are farmed, but the fish do occur naturally in the wild waters off South Australia too, and are also known as amberjack and yellowtail. The hiramasa name, however, is attributed to the Australian farmed variety, differentiating it from the declining wild population. The hirasama is surrounded by roasted red and … perry jordan rate my professorWeb12 gen 2024 · The term hiramasa refers to Seriola lalandi, the yellowtail amberjack. Although most sushi menus in North America translate hamachi as “yellowtail” (and vice versa), this is erroneous.
